An earthquake shook things up in Central Virginia on Friday. At 5:52 p.m. on Friday, March 20, an earthquake rattled Central Virginia, according to StormTracker8 chief meteorologist Matt DiNardo. Our ...
According to the United States Geological Survey, an earthquake registering 2.1 magnitude took place in Appomattox County.
